Council of Europe knows about every violation of human rights in Crimea – Chubarov
Chairman of the Mejlis of the Crimean Tatar People Refat Chubarov met with the Council of Europe Commissioner for Human Rights Nils Muiznieks in Strasbourg on Wednesday to discuss the situation in Crimea and related human rights issue.
"The meeting with Council of Europe Commissioner for Human Rights Nils Muiznieks was [held] in Strasbourg. The questions regarding Crimea and human rights in the occupied peninsula were discussed. [I] can assure you that Muiznieks with his team carefully monitor the situation in Crimea and know about every case of the violation of human rights," Chubarov wrote on Facebook.
Chubarov also said that PACE (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e) deputies on Wednesday took part in a roundtable talk on countering Russian aggression and returning Crimea to Ukraine.
